And indeed, the store is full of gift ideas for someone who might very well be into Mr. Joel: colorful picture frames, carved wooden cats, a whole shelf of guardian angel figurines, and home decor objects sharing a Zen, world-traveler vibe. Basically, stuff you'd find in a crib that's calm, tastefully decorated, and not often host to the sorts of rowdy parties at which things get broken. A painted sign outside advises, ""Love is the only thing of value that we leave behind"" - which may be true, but Aumakua also features an impressive selection of pretty sterling-silver earrings in a variety of classic styles, all priced around $25. Perfect for the Storm Front fan or anyone who appreciates unique jewelry that'll never look too last-season to wear over and over. Seasonal note: Aumakua also carries a wide range of Christmas ornaments around the holidays.
